Skip to content

Commit 0913be2

Browse files
committed
Bugfix. Views.
Fixes issue: Not valid view names in dashboards.
1 parent 521b562 commit 0913be2

File tree

1 file changed

+8
-2
lines changed

1 file changed

+8
-2
lines changed

plugins/views/api/api.js

+8-2
Original file line numberDiff line numberDiff line change
@@ -2060,8 +2060,14 @@ const escapedViewSegments = { "name": true, "segment": true, "height": true, "wi
20602060
}
20612061
dati[z].u = dati[z].uvalue || dati[z].u;
20622062
dati[z].views = dati[z]._id;
2063-
if (dati[z].view_meta && dati[z].view_meta[0] && dati[z].view_meta[0].view) {
2064-
dati[z].views = dati[z].view_meta[0].display || dati[z].view_meta[0].view;
2063+
if (dati[z].view_meta && dati[z].view_meta[0]) {
2064+
if (dati[z].view_meta[0].view) {
2065+
dati[z].views = dati[z].view_meta[0].view;
2066+
}
2067+
2068+
if (dati[z].view_meta[0].display) {
2069+
dati[z].views = dati[z].view_meta[0].display;
2070+
}
20652071
}
20662072
}
20672073
if (dati) {

0 commit comments

Comments
 (0)